Electric Powertrains: One of the most significant breakthroughs in the motorcycle industry is the rise of electric powertrains. Electric motorcycles, propelled by high-capacity batteries and efficient motors, are gaining traction for their environmental sustainability and impressive performance. With improved battery technology, electric bikes now offer longer ranges and faster charging times, making them more practical for everyday use and long-distance rides. Electric powertrains provide instant torque, delivering exhilarating acceleration and a silent yet powerful ride.

Connectivity and Smart Features: Motorcycles are becoming more connected than ever before, thanks to advancements in connectivity technology. Integrated GPS systems provide real-time navigation, enabling riders to discover new routes and avoid traffic congestion. Bluetooth connectivity allows riders to sync their smartphones with their motorcycles, providing access to music, calls, and messages without compromising safety. Furthermore, some motorcycles offer voice command functionality, allowing riders to control various features hands-free. Connectivity features enhance convenience, safety, and entertainment, making each ride a connected experience.

Advanced Rider-Assistance Systems (ARAS): Safety is a paramount concern in motorcycling, and the latest technological breakthroughs are focused on enhancing rider safety. Advanced Rider-Assistance Systems (ARAS) employ sensors, cameras, and artificial intelligence algorithms to detect potential hazards and assist riders in real-time. Features such as adaptive cruise control, blind-spot monitoring, and collision warning systems provide riders with an additional layer of safety. ARAS technologies work together to mitigate risks and prevent accidents, making motorcycling safer and more enjoyable.

Augmented Reality (AR) Displays: Augmented Reality (AR) is transforming the way riders interact with their motorcycles and the environment around them. AR displays integrated into helmets or visors overlay important information onto the rider’s field of vision. Riders can access vital data such as speed, navigation instructions, and hazard alerts without taking their eyes off the road. AR displays also have the potential to enhance group riding experiences, allowing riders to communicate and share information in real-time. By keeping riders focused and informed, AR displays contribute to safer and more immersive rides.

Materials and Design Innovations: Motorcycle manufacturers are constantly exploring new materials and design techniques to improve performance, efficiency, and aesthetics. Lightweight materials such as carbon fiber and aluminum alloys are being used to reduce weight without compromising strength and durability. Advanced aerodynamic designs optimize airflow and reduce drag, resulting in improved stability and fuel efficiency. These innovations enhance handling, agility, and overall riding dynamics, allowing riders to unleash the full potential of their motorcycles.

With each new breakthrough, motorcycles are becoming more than just machines; they are evolving into intelligent companions that cater to the needs and desires of riders. The integration of artificial intelligence and machine learning algorithms is paving the way for motorcycles that can learn and adapt to rider preferences and riding styles. These smart motorcycles can analyze data from sensors, adjust suspension settings, fine-tune power delivery, and even provide personalized recommendations for optimal performance and comfort.

Furthermore, the advent of autonomous technology is on the horizon, promising a paradigm shift in the way motorcycles operate. While fully autonomous motorcycles may still be a concept for the future, semi-autonomous features are already making their way into the industry. Systems that assist with parking, low-speed maneuvers, and collision avoidance are being developed, offering an extra layer of safety and convenience.

In the realm of energy efficiency, motorcycles are embracing sustainable practices. Alongside electric powertrains, alternative fuel options such as hydrogen and biofuels are being explored, aiming to reduce carbon emissions and reliance on fossil fuels. With advancements in renewable energy sources and infrastructure, motorcycles of the future may offer greener and more sustainable mobility options.

The role of data and connectivity in motorcycling is expanding rapidly. Manufacturers are harnessing the power of big data to gain insights into rider behavior, performance metrics, and predictive maintenance. This data-driven approach allows for more personalized experiences, improved safety measures, and optimized maintenance schedules, ultimately enhancing the overall ownership experience.

The future of motorcycling is not just about the technology within the machines themselves but also the ecosystem in which they operate. Smart cities and intelligent transportation systems are evolving to accommodate motorcycles, with dedicated lanes, enhanced infrastructure, and vehicle-to-vehicle communication. These developments aim to create a harmonious environment where motorcycles can coexist seamlessly with other road users, ensuring efficient and safe mobility.
